Electrical Safety Fundamentals: Essential Knowledge for Electricians

Safety protocols are paramount when working with electricity. Electricians must possess a comprehensive understanding of electrical safety fundamentals to minimize the risk of injury or fatalities.

A fundamental principle is recognizing the inherent dangers of electricity. Current can cause severe burns, muscle contractions, and even cardiac arrest. Electricians should always treat all electrical sources as potentially hazardous, regardless of their perceived voltage level.

It's crucial to examine tools and equipment regularly for damage or wear and tear before each use. Damaged insulation, frayed wires, or loose connections can create a pathway for electricity to flow unexpectedly, leading to shocks or fires.

Before beginning any electrical work, always de-energize the power source. This involves switching off the circuit breaker or using lockout/tagout procedures to ensure that no current is flowing through the circuits you are working on.

Remember to use insulated tools and wear personal protective equipment (PPE), such as rubber gloves and safety glasses, to further protect yourself from electrical hazards.

Always check the appropriate wiring diagrams and schematics before performing any electrical installations or repairs. This will help you understand the circuit layout and identify potential hazards.

Troubleshooting Electrical Problems: Diagnose and Repair with Confidence

Electrical faults can be intimidating, but with a systematic approach, you can diagnose and repair them with confidence. Start by locating the specific problem. Is it a blown fuse, a tripped circuit breaker, or something more complex? Meticulously inspect wires, outlets, and appliances for any signs of damage or wear.

If you're comfortable working with electricity, utilize a multimeter to test voltage and continuity. Always stress safety by turning off the power at the breaker box before performing any repairs. Remember, if you're unsure about anything, it's best to consult a qualified electrician.

A well-stocked toolbox containing essential electrical tools can be invaluable when troubleshooting problems.

Make sure your kit includes:

  • Wire strippers
  • Non-contact voltage detector
  • Screwdrivers (various sizes)

By following these tips, you can effectively resolve electrical problems in your home or workspace.
